TAP208153 is an electric transmission substation in Colorado, operated by WAPA-- WESTERN AREA POWER ADMINISTRATION. It is classified as sub-transmission (138 kv) and connects 3 transmission lines. Substation proximity is one of the strongest speed-to-power signals for siting a datacenter — interconnection distance to an energized, high-voltage bus is often the binding constraint on time-to-energization.
